Key concepts and overview
Cashback bonuses are promotional offers that return a percentage of a player’s losses over a specified period. Unlike traditional bonuses that require a deposit or specific wagering, cashback is typically calculated based on net losses, making it a more straightforward and appealing option for many gamblers. This type of bonus can vary significantly between different casinos, with some offering a flat percentage while others may have tiered systems based on the player’s activity level. Main features and details
Cashback bonuses generally come with specific terms and conditions that players must be aware of. Here are some key components:
- Eligibility: Not all players may qualify for cashback bonuses. Some casinos restrict these offers to certain games or require players to opt-in.
- Calculation Method: The cashback amount is usually calculated based on the player’s net losses, which is the total amount wagered minus any winnings. This can be calculated daily, weekly, or monthly, depending on the casino’s policy.
- Withdrawal Conditions: Cashback bonuses may have specific withdrawal conditions, such as minimum wagering requirements before players can cash out their bonus funds.
- Expiration Dates: Many cashback offers come with expiration dates, meaning players must use their bonuses within a certain timeframe to avoid losing them.
Understanding these features helps players navigate the complexities of cashback bonuses and make informed decisions about their gambling activities.
Practical examples and use cases
To illustrate how cashback bonuses work in practice, consider the following scenarios:
- Scenario 1: A player deposits $500 and wagers a total of $2,000 over a week, resulting in $1,500 in losses. If the casino offers a 10% cashback bonus, the player would receive $150 back, which can be used for future bets.
- Scenario 2: A high roller who regularly plays at an online casino may be eligible for a tiered cashback system. For instance, they might receive 5% cashback on losses up to $1,000 and 10% on losses exceeding that amount, providing a substantial return on their gambling activity.
